Before you start installing the cylinder, you'll need to make sure that the machine is properly prepared. This means turning off the power, releasing any pressure in the system, and cleaning the mounting surface. You'll also want to check the machine's specifications to make sure that the cylinder is compatible with the machine's requirements.

Once the machine is ready, it's time to start installing the cylinder. The first step is to position the cylinder on the mounting surface and align it with the mounting holes. You'll want to make sure that the cylinder is centered and level, and that the mounting holes are properly aligned.

Next, you'll need to insert the mounting bolts through the holes in the cylinder and the mounting surface. Make sure that the bolts are tightened securely, but don't over-tighten them. Over-tightening can damage the cylinder or the mounting surface, and it can also cause the cylinder to malfunction.

After the cylinder is mounted, you'll need to connect the air supply lines. The ack 90 degrees twist clamp cylinder typically uses a standard pneumatic connection, so you'll need to make sure that the air supply lines are properly connected and tightened. You'll also want to check the air pressure to make sure that it's within the recommended range for the cylinder.

Once the air supply lines are connected, it's time to test the cylinder. You can do this by turning on the power and activating the cylinder. Make sure that the cylinder moves smoothly and that it provides a secure clamping force at a 90-degree angle. If you notice any problems, you'll need to troubleshoot the issue and make any necessary adjustments.
